When the gold is encapsulated in the sulphide matrix, dissolved oxygen and cyanide cannot reach the gold minerals' surface. It causes poor gold extraction [14].In this regard, gold ores can be categorized into "refractory ores'' and "free milling" based on their response to cyanidation [46].Under the standard leaching condition, the gold ores that yield …

Can gold miners say 'sayonara' to cyanide?
The difficult-to-process ore has very high levels of carbonaceous, "preg-robbing" material which competes with activated carbon in the cyanidation process to capture the gold. Barrick's thiosulphate processing plant poured its first gold at the end of 2014, but the plant has underperformed on recoveries, Raponi notes.

Advances in the Cyanidation of Gold
In the case of cyanidation plants processing gold ores with metallic sulfides, oxygen is not only used to optimize plant throughput but also to enhance gold extraction. Because the dissolution of sulfide minerals consumes oxygen ( (26.8), (26.10), (26.11) ), it is important to avoid a reduction in the gold-leaching rate associated with low DO ...

Gold Processing Steps 101: Essential Guide
Cyanide leaching is the go-to way to get gold out of ore. In this step, the pre-oxidized ore slurry is mixed with a weak sodium cyanide solution (around 0.01-0.05% NaCN) in big tanks called leach tanks. Gold Process Equipment
Gold Ore Processing. Carbon-in-pulp (CIP) consists of cyanide leaching and then absorption of gold from ore, which is considered a simple and cheap process. Using a CIP gold processing plant, pulp flows through tanks where sodium cyanide and oxygen help dissolve gold into solution. CIP plants are similar to Carbon-in-leach plants.
